The Malonic Ester Synthesis typically involves the alkylation of a malonic ester, followed by hydrolysis and decarboxylation. Diethyl Benzylmalonate, with its existing benzyl substituent on the alpha carbon, offers a head start in building more complex structures. This pre-installed functionality simplifies the synthetic route and enhances efficiency. The predictable reactivity and well-understood properties of diethyl benzylmalonate make it a favorite among synthetic chemists aiming to introduce specific side chains or build steric bulk around a central carbon atom.

The true elegance of using Diethyl Benzylmalonate in this synthesis lies in its ability to undergo sequential alkylations. This allows for the introduction of two different groups onto the alpha carbon, leading to highly substituted compounds with quaternary centers. The subsequent decarboxylation step then yields a carboxylic acid or ketone derivative, with the benzyl group remaining intact.
